the state of being voluble
— His volubility had left him at last, and he sank down wearily on my sofa. I felt that no words of condolence availed, and I let him lie there quietly.
- the degree to which someone is voluble
词形变化
词源
From Latin volūbilitās. By surface analysis, voluble + -ity.
